Rest in Peace Gareth

You may have read our brief social media announcement a few days ago that on the afternoon of Saturday 17th June whilst preparing at the Brangwyn Hall in Swansea for our Annual Gala Concert, one of our choristers, top tenor Gareth Jefferies suddenly collapsed. Sadly despite the best efforts of the Choir's first aiders, the Brangwyn Hall first aid team and the Welsh Ambulance Service. Gareth passed away. 

A fuller tribute has now been posted on our social media pages and it is reproduced here in memory of someone who was more than just a chorister of the Morriston Orpheus.

For 12 years consecutively he held one of the hardest jobs of any choir, holding the position of Stage Marshall. He dedicated many hours of his time ensuring that every stage plan of any concert venue we performed at was accommodating for us as a Choir. He discussed with countless venues before each and every concert to ensure we had the ease of settling into our positions on the concert stage and the concert would run as smooth as possible. He carried out this role to absolute perfection.

Gareth was fiercely proud to be a Morriston Orpheus Chorister and was always one of the first to welcome any new chorister into the ranks.On Saturday, Gareth was to receive his 20 year award for outstanding service to The Orpheus, and when the time is right, we will continue to honour this with all of Gareth’s family.

Since our previous announcement we have been inundated with so many comments and so many stories about other people’s memories of Gareth, all of which have been a huge source of help and comfort to both Gareth’s Family and his wider Orpheus Family. It just goes to show the absolute measure of such a great man.

Gareth, on behalf of us all, we say thank you for everything you did for us. We thank you for your dedication, but most of all we thank you for being you! A friend to all! Always smiling, always laughing, and always encouraging.
